Markle’s PDA initially sparked controversy since royal couples, like Prince William and Kate Middleton, rarely show any form of it.
“people are really attacking meghan markle because she was holding her HUSBAND’S hand during a memorial for his dead grandmother… like it’s so weird how people will finding [sic] any reason to be mad at her like let her show affection to her own husband,” one angry fan tweeted.
“Acceptable: Holding your partner’s hand whilst mourning your grandmother* *unless your partner is Meghan Markle,” another wrote. people are really attacking meghan markle because she was holding her HUSBAND’S hand during a memorial for his dead grandmother… like it’s so weird how people will finding any reason to be mad at her like let her show affection to her own husband“This is where criticism of Meghan Markle and Harry get’s [sic] silly.
“Meghan Markle holds her husband’s hand at his grandmother’s funeral. How dare she comfort her grieving husband,” someone else wrote.Markle initially left people torn over the slight display of affection.Getty Images
